Unit 2 Vocabulary
Fract/Fring/Frang - Cis/Caedere - Tom - Punct
Question | Answer |
---|---|
Fractious | Tending to argue or cause discord |
Infraction | Minor violation of a rule or law |
Infringe | To intrude on an area belonging to another; to trespass |
Excise | To cut out of; remove |
Incisive | Sharply cutting; direct and powerful |
Concise | Brief and straightforward |
Tome | A large and serious book |
Epitome | The best or most typical example |
Dichotomy | Two opposite parts of one whole |
Anatomy | The structure or parts, taken as a whole |
Compunction | Feeling of regret or remorse |
Punctilious | Paying strict attention to detail; extremely careful |
Pungent | Stinging or biting, especially in taste or smell |
